所有文章 > 当前标签:API
Istio 使用 GatewayAPI实现流量管理
Istio 使用 GatewayAPI实现流量管理
2025/03/03
Gateway API 是由 SIG-NETWORK 社区管理的开源项目,项目地址:https://gateway-api.sigs.k8s.io/。主要原因是 Ingress 资源对象不能很好的满足网络需求,很多场景下 Ingress 控制器都需要通过定义 annotations 或者 crd 来进行功能扩展,这对于使用标准和支持是非常不利的,新推出的 Gateway API 旨在通过可扩展的面向角色的接口来增强服务网络
使用Java GitLab API获取项目分支信息
使用Java GitLab API获取项目分支信息
【学习各类API】 在使用GitLab进行项目管理时,常常需要获取项目的分支信息。通过Java GitLab API,我们可以方便地获取这些信息,而无需通过本地克隆仓库的方式。本文详细介绍了如何使用Java GitLab API来获取GitLab项目的分支信息,包括如何配置API依赖项、设置访问令牌,以及通过调用API方法来获取项目信息和分支信息的具体步骤。
2025/03/03
GitLabAPI获取所有文件的解决方案
GitLabAPI获取所有文件的解决方案
【学习各类API】 GitLab API 是获取项目文件的强大工具,但直接获取项目下所有文件名的功能尚未直接提供。为了获取完整的文件列表,我们可以采用多种策略,例如通过API接口逐层遍历目录结构,或者借助GitLab页面接口实现文件名查找。通过这些方法,我们能够有效地获取项目所有文件,并应对大规模项目管理中的挑战。
2025/03/03
管理GitLab的APIToken入门指南
管理GitLab的APIToken入门指南
【学习各类API】 本文提供了关于如何管理GitLab的API Token的详细指南。GitLab的API Token是访问和操作GitLab资源的关键工具。本文将详细介绍如何生成和使用个人访问令牌,以及如何在Jenkins中配置GitLab API Token。通过遵循这些步骤,用户可以有效地管理他们的GitLab项目和资源。
2025/03/03
GitLabAPI工具类的深入使用和实现
GitLabAPI工具类的深入使用和实现
【学习各类API】 在现代软件开发中,GitLab作为一种强大的分布式版本控制系统,越来越受到开发者的青睐。为了提高开发效率,我们可以通过GitLab API进行自动化操作,如分支管理、代码提交等。这篇文章介绍了如何通过GitLab API工具类来实现这些功能,涵盖了项目信息查询、分支管理、历史记录获取以及分支包含关系比较等实用功能。使用这些API,我们可以减少繁琐的手动操作,极大地提高工作效率。
2025/03/03
聊聊Api接口优化的几个方法
聊聊Api接口优化的几个方法
【日积月累】 背景 我负责的系统到2021年初完成了功能上的建设,开始进入到推广阶段。随着推广的逐步深入,收到了很多好评的同时也收到了很多对性能的吐槽。刚刚收到吐槽的时候,我们的心情是这样的: 当越来越多对性能的吐槽反馈到我们这里的时...
2025/02/28
什么是API接口响应规范
什么是API接口响应规范
【日积月累】 API接口响应规范定义了返回数据格式、状态码和错误信息,提升开发效率、系统稳定性和用户体验,是开发中不可或缺的标准。
2025/02/26
Salesforce元数据API开发指南
Salesforce元数据API开发指南
【学习各类API】 本指南详细介绍了如何使用Salesforce元数据API进行CRUD操作与文件管理,以及如何在Salesforce平台上实现高效的定制化元数据管理。文档针对Salesforce开发人员,提供了从基础知识到高级技巧的全面指导,帮助开发者更好地利用API进行安全、高效的元数据操作。
2025/02/26
如何用Laravel开发API
如何用Laravel开发API
【日积月累】 本指南详细介绍了如何使用Laravel框架开发一个功能齐全的API,涵盖了从环境搭建到服务层创建的每一个步骤。您将学习如何下载并配置Laravel项目,设置API路由,创建控制器和服务层,以及如何实现统一的API响应和参数校验。此外,我们还将介绍如何监听SQL语句,以帮助您在开发过程中进行调试和优化。这些步骤将帮助您快速上手Laravel,并为您的应用程序提供强大的API接口。
2025/02/26
API与区块链的集成探索与应用
API与区块链的集成探索与应用
【日积月累】 区块链技术正在颠覆金融服务,而通过API与百度智能云千帆大模型平台的集成应用,这一技术的优势被进一步放大。本文深入探讨了区块链综合服务API的应用场景及其与大模型平台结合的潜力,为开发者提供了详细的指导,帮助他们在金融、电子商务以及数据分析等领域实现技术突破。通过对安全性、易用性和合规性的分析,本文为企业和开发者提供了全面的风险评估和解决方案。
2025/02/26
API开发中的安全性测试
API开发中的安全性测试
【日积月累】 在现代软件开发中,API已成为应用之间通信的重要桥梁。然而,API的安全性问题也随之而来,成为开发者关注的重点。API安全性测试是确保API能够抵御各种攻击的关键步骤,如SQL注入、跨站脚本(XSS)和跨站请求伪造(CSRF)等。本文将介绍如何使用Postman进行API安全性测试,包括准备环境、识别漏洞以及进行认证和授权测试等,以帮助开发者确保API的安全性。
2025/02/26
ReactNativeFabric渲染器API解析
ReactNativeFabric渲染器API解析
【学习各类API】 本文介绍了React Native中Fabric渲染器的架构和API。Fabric是React Native新架构的重要组成部分,通过将渲染逻辑从Native(Android/iOS)侧统一到C++侧,提升了跨平台的一致性和性能。文章详细分析了Fabric渲染器在创建和更新Shadow Tree的流程,以及如何通过JSI实现高效通信。通过对比旧架构,本文帮助读者更好地理解Fabric在React Native渲染流水线中的角色。
2025/02/26
API与人工智能的结合推动技术变革
API与人工智能的结合推动技术变革
【日积月累】 随着人工智能技术的快速发展和API接口的广泛应用,它们的结合在许多领域中发挥着重要作用。API作为应用程序接口,为人工智能提供了标准化的通信方式,使得不同软件和系统能够无缝集成。这种结合不仅在提高效率和降低成本方面具有显著优势,还在推动智能咨询、金融风控等新型业务模式的诞生中扮演着重要角色。API的安全性和稳定性对于保障人工智能技术的可靠性和商业应用至关重要。确保API接口的安全性能够有效防止数据泄露和黑客攻击,保护企业的知识产权和用户的敏感信息。这种协同作用将继续推动人工智能技术的普及和深入应用。
2025/02/26
API与微服务通信协议详解
API与微服务通信协议详解
【日积月累】 本文深入探讨了微服务的多种通信方式,包括RESTful API、RPC、消息队列、事件驱动和WebSocket等。这些通信协议是现代微服务架构中不可或缺的部分,各具优势,适用于不同的业务场景。通过对比RESTful API与RPC的不同特性,读者可以更好地理解如何在微服务应用中选择合适的通信协议来实现高效、可靠的服务间交互。
2025/02/26
API与Kafka的集成指南
API与Kafka的集成指南
【日积月累】 在现代应用中,API与Kafka的集成是实现实时数据处理和高效消息传递的关键。Kafka作为一个高吞吐量的分布式消息系统,可以通过Java API和Spring Boot实现灵活的集成。这一过程不仅支持发布和消费消息,还提供了可靠的消息传递保证。本文将深入探讨Kafka的基本概念、Java API操作以及与Spring Boot的无缝结合。
2025/02/26
什么是SalesforceAPI
什么是SalesforceAPI
【API术语解释】 Salesforce API 是 Salesforce 平台提供的一组接口,允许开发者与 Salesforce 数据进行交互。通过这些 API,开发者可以访问、修改和集成 Salesforce 数据,以满足企业的特定需求。Salesforce 提供了多种 API,包括 REST API、SOAP API、Bulk API 和 Streaming API,每种 API 都有其独特的功能和使用场景。这些 API 的开发和演变反映了 Salesforce 平台在适应不同集成需求和技术标准方面的持续进步。
2025/02/26